Output 28e0291285757b7b72e85d0e6d33598923bf341b121ed9cfce172fb250ab74b7:0

value
66460683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e6836b638f8f75226eeb8bb4e90584bf1d088a OP_EQUAL
address
3NZL8dVPYzj7okR41AC4FWDzt5xEFxG33w
transaction
28e0291285757b7b72e85d0e6d33598923bf341b121ed9cfce172fb250ab74b7
spent
true